The daily lemming

Posted by Robin on 25 June 2024 12 Comments

From Paper Mate, Sunday Brunch Scented Flair Felt Tip Pens: "Since the 1960s, Paper Mate Flair pens have been a favorite way to add a splash of color to your work, whether you're color-coding lists, decorating scrapbooks, or sketching out your latest art project. This limited edition Sunday Brunch set features delightfully sweet scented ink, inspired by the sights and smells of a brunch table... This set includes 6 delectable colors with matching scents: Floral Blossoms, Hazelnut Latte, Homemade Raspberry Jam, Honeydew Melon, Sugared Grapefruit, and Vanilla Blueberry Tart." $10.50 at Jet Pens.
